May 1st is School Lunch Hero Day

Published

on

May 1st is the 8th Annual School Lunch Hero Day and Warren County Public Schools is saluting its School Nutrition Services staff, who are providing an average of nearly 1,000 meals daily. The average number of students served is 620 daily, 4,340 per week. Since April they have served 35,780 meals. Special thanks to the 28 frontline employees and volunteers who make this happen.

Even during school closures during the COVID-19 pandemic, the School Nutrition Services staff has been committed to ensuring that children have access to healthy school breakfasts and lunches.

From the Warren County Public Schools website:

Warren County PS Child Nutrition will be providing bagged meals while schools are closed.

Updated Information regarding Meals: 3/29/2020

Warren County Public Schools Transportation Department and the Food Service Department are partnering to provide meals to additional delivery sites in neighborhoods that are outside of the town limits. Please see this map for locations

Meals will be delivered weekly on Monday, Wednesday, and Friday. Monday and Wednesday’s meal delivery will include breakfast and lunch for two days, and Friday’s delivery will include breakfast and lunch for three days. Below is the schedule.

Warren County PS Child Nutrition will be providing bagged meals while schools are closed.

Where: E. Wilson Morrison Elementary School

When: 11:00 am until 1:00 pm   Monday, Wednesday, Friday

How: Meals will be handed out in the Drive-through area next to the cafeteria (Walk-up service is also available)

Additional sights where meals will be delivered to the following locations on Monday, Wednesday, and Friday at the following times: 

  • Ressie Jeffries Elementary School (320 East Criser Road): 11 am- 11:15 am
  • Royal Arms Apartments (401 East Criser Road): 11:20 am- 11:35 am
  • Royal Hill Apartments (31 Royal Lane): 11:40 am- 11:55 am
  • Skyline Vista Apartments (343 Kendrick Lane): 12:10pm – 12:25 pm
  • Front Royal Church of the Nazarene (1107 Monroe Avenue): 12:30 pm -12:45 pm
  • Brinklow Road (including Hattie Street and James Street): 1 pm-1:15 pm

Warren County Public Schools buses will be delivering meals to the following locations on Monday, Wednesday, and Friday at the following times:

  • Lake Front Royal Bus Loop 11 am * Reliance Methodist Church 11:45 am
  • Dismal Hollow Kiss N Ride 11 am *Apple Mt Bus Loop 11:30 am * Freezeland Mt/Thompson Kiss N Ride 12:00 noon
  • Shenandoah Shores Fire Dept. 11 am * Venus Branch/Old Oak Bus Loop 11:45 am * N. Warren Fire Station 12:30 pm
  • Rivermont Fire Station 11 am *Fortsmouth Fire Station 11:45 am
  • Fetchett Rd/Skyline Trailer Ct 11 am * Browntown Community Center/South Warren Substation 11:20 am * South Warren Fire Station 11:45 am

 

Cost: Meals will be provided free of charge

Who: Children 18 years of age or younger. Percurrent Federal regulations, children MUST BE PRESENT to receive meals.

What: Both breakfast and a Lunch will be provided in one visit, each day, to each child present.

*(A Breakfast consists of a breakfast entrée, a juice, and a fruit)

*(A Lunch consists of a sandwich, fruit, juice, vegetable, and milk)

** Items not eaten upon receiving need to be refrigerated 

Note: These meals are planned to avoid most known allergies we are aware our students have, should a child receiving meals have an allergy, please let the person providing your meals know and we will provide you an alternate item.
